Kinds Of Scaffolding
Although scaffolding systems can differ extensively in style and application, they generally drop right into numerous distinctive categories that accommodate different building needs - Scaffolding. The most usual types include sustained scaffolding, put on hold scaffolding, and rolling scaffolding
Sustained scaffolding includes platforms sustained by a structure of poles, which supply a stable and elevated working surface. This kind is generally utilized for tasks that call for significant elevation, such as bricklaying or external painting.
Suspended scaffolding, conversely, is used for jobs needing access to high altitudes, such as cleansing or repairing building exteriors. This system hangs from an additional framework or a roof, permitting employees to reduced or elevate the system as required.
Rolling scaffolding functions wheels that allow for easy movement across a job site. It is specifically valuable for jobs that need frequent moving, such as indoor job in huge areas.
Each type of scaffolding is developed with specific applications in mind, guaranteeing that construction projects can be accomplished effectively and properly. Recognizing these groups is important for selecting the appropriate scaffolding system to meet both project needs and site conditions.
Secret Safety And Security Functions
Safety is paramount in scaffolding systems, as the possible dangers associated with operating at elevations can result in serious crashes otherwise effectively handled. Key security features are crucial to make certain the wellness of employees and the stability of the building and construction website.
Most importantly, guardrails are critical. These barriers give a physical secure versus falls, dramatically minimizing the risk of significant injuries. In addition, toe boards are typically made use of to avoid devices and materials from diminishing the scaffold, protecting workers listed below.
Another essential part is making use of non-slip surfaces on platforms. This attribute boosts grip, especially in adverse weather, therefore minimizing the likelihood of drops and slides. Access ladders need to be safely placed to promote secure access and departure from the scaffold.
Routine examinations and upkeep of scaffolding systems are likewise vital. These inspections ensure that all parts are in great problem and working correctly, attending to any kind of wear or damages immediately.
Finally, proper training for all employees associated with scaffolding procedures is important to guarantee that they recognize security methods and can determine prospective risks. Scaffolding. Collectively, these attributes create a much safer working atmosphere and dramatically reduce dangers associated with scaffolding
Product Advancements
Advancements in material scientific research have actually substantially affected the scaffolding market, improving both safety and security and efficiency in modern construction. The intro of high-strength steel and aluminum alloys has actually reinvented traditional scaffolding systems. These materials are not just lighter, making them less complicated to transport and assemble, however additionally supply remarkable load-bearing capabilities. This results in scaffolding frameworks that can sustain higher weights while lessening the danger of collapse.
Furthermore, ingenious composite materials, such as fiberglass-reinforced plastics, have actually arised as sensible alternatives. These products are immune to corrosion and environmental destruction, hence prolonging the life-span of scaffolding systems, specifically in extreme climate condition. Using such materials adds to lower upkeep costs and makes certain consistent efficiency over time.

Design Factors To Consider
Considering the intricacies of modern building jobs, effective scaffolding layout is critical to making certain both functionality and safety and security. Layout considerations need to incorporate different variables, consisting of tons ability, height, and the certain needs of the construction site. Each task presents distinct obstacles, demanding a flexible approach to scaffolding systems that can adapt to varying conditions.
Architectural stability is important; as a result, designers must compute the loads that the scaffolding will support, consisting of employees, products, and tools. The choice of materials plays a vital duty in making sure the scaffolding can withstand these tons while staying light-weight and sturdy. Additionally, the design should enable for simple gain access to and egress, assisting in the smooth activity of personnel and materials.
Safety functions, such as guardrails and non-slip surfaces, ought to be integrated to reduce risks of crashes. The layout has to take into consideration the surrounding atmosphere, including nearby structures and potential threats. By resolving these style considerations, construction companies can improve the efficiency of scaffolding systems and promote a more secure working setting, eventually contributing to the overall success of the project.
Upkeep and Evaluations
The effectiveness of scaffolding systems expands beyond initial layout and execution; continuous maintenance and routine examinations are essential to guaranteeing their continued performance and security throughout the duration of a job. Regular examinations ought to be conducted by certified workers to identify any type of indicators of wear, damages, or instability that might jeopardize the honesty of the scaffolding.
Maintenance procedures should consist of regular checks of architectural elements, such as planks, frameworks, and fittings, making sure that all components stay totally free and secure from corrosion or other deterioration. Additionally, the capability of security functions, such as guardrails and toe boards, have to be evaluated to make sure conformity with security laws.
Documentation of all evaluations and maintenance tasks is essential for liability and regulatory compliance. A systematic method to record-keeping not just help in tracking the condition of the scaffolding but likewise supplies needed proof in case of an event.
